24FC16-I/ST Description
The 24FC16-I/ST is a high-performance, 16Kbit EEPROM memory IC chip designed by Microchip Technology. This device features a 2K x 8 memory organization, providing a robust solution for applications requiring non-volatile memory storage. The 24FC16-I/ST operates within a wide voltage range of 1.7V to 5.5V, ensuring compatibility with various power supply configurations. It supports a clock frequency of up to 1 MHz, enabling fast data access and efficient communication through its I2C interface. With an access time of 450 ns and a write cycle time of 5ms for word and page operations, this EEPROM offers a balance of speed and reliability.
The 24FC16-I/ST is housed in an 8TSSOP package and is available in tube packaging, making it suitable for surface-mount applications. This chip is REACH unaffected and RoHS3 compliant, adhering to stringent environmental and safety standards. Its moisture sensitivity level (MSL) is rated at 1 (unlimited), ensuring it can withstand typical manufacturing environments without degradation.
